extinction broodmother
so im playing extinction and i spawn at the center of the place (i fordit what its calld) but theres like three broodmothers and im like hmmmm and im playing some more and i come back and there are 10 or more of them is this supposed to happen
Originally posted by Sicksadpanda:
I did a little research, apparently lootmod has broodmother spawning on all maps. Remove that mod and that should remove them (if that doesn't, do a dino wipe, and that'll end them permanently).

🦊 Hermit Jan 13, 2019 @ 6:21am 
The lower levels of the Extinction sanctuary are considered a swamp area, many swamp creatures like snakes and kapros spawn there. However broodmothers will never spawn there by default, even in a swamp, they just do not exist in any form on Extinction, not even as a boss.

If you are getting broodmothers spawning then either:

1) You are using a mod which is spawning them. Most mods which add them do have them spawning in the swamp. If this is the case then as Shiro says they will probably not be vanilla broods, so you'll have to find their creature ID from the mod page they come from.

2) The config settings of your server/solo game are set up to spawn them as normal creatures, despite the fact that they are bosses. If that's the case then you'll have to shut down your server/game, remove that config setting, then start up again and do a dino wipe to remove the ones which are in the world already.
